These are printable activity sheets that present a series of numbered or lettered dots, demanding connection in sequential order to reveal a concealed image. The complexity arises from the sheer number of points involved, the intricate arrangement of these points across the page, or the subtlety of the resultant picture. An example might involve several hundred dots carefully positioned to create a detailed landscape or portrait, where misconnection would significantly distort the final result.
The significance of advanced connect-the-dot puzzles lies in their cognitive benefits, challenging visual-spatial reasoning and fine motor skills. Historically, simpler versions have served as children’s educational tools. The more challenging iterations, however, provide engaging mental exercises for adults, offering a form of focused relaxation and promoting concentration. They can also be utilized therapeutically to improve hand-eye coordination and visual perception skills following injury or illness.
